Posted 2023 اپريل 3, سومر
3سال
ISFJ
لبرا
API ٽيسٽنگ
API ٽيسٽنگ بنيادي API ٽيسٽنگ هڪ API (ايپليڪيشن پروگرامنگ انٽرفيس) جي ڪارڪردگي، اعتبار، ۽ سيڪيورٽي کي جانچڻ جو عمل آهي. ان ۾ هڪ API ڏانهن درخواستون موڪلڻ ۽ جواب جي تصديق ڪرڻ شامل آهي، گڏوگڏ مختلف منظرنامن کي جانچڻ جهڙوڪ غلطي جي سنڀال، تصديق، ۽ ڊيٽا جي تصديق. API ٽيسٽنگ لاءِ ڪيترائي اوزار موجود آهن، بشمول Postman، SoapUI، Insomnia، ۽ JMeter. اهي اوزار توهان کي API ڏانهن درخواستون ٺاهڻ ۽ موڪلڻ، ۽ جواب جو تجزيو ڪرڻ جي اجازت ڏين ٿا. API کي جانچڻ وقت، مختلف HTTP طريقيڪار جهڙوڪ GET، POST، PUT، DELETE، PATCH، ۽ HEAD کي جانچڻ اهم آهي. توهان کي مختلف ڊيٽا فارميٽ جهڙوڪ XML، JSON، ۽ YAML کي پڻ جانچڻ گهرجي. جانچڻ لاءِ ٻيا اهم پہلو شامل آهن: تصديق: جانچيو ته ڇا API تصديق جي ضرورت آهي ۽ ڇا اهو صحيح ڪم ڪري رهيو آهي. اجازت: جانچيو ته ڇا API درخواستن کي صحيح طريقي سان صارف جي ڪردار ۽ اجازت جي بنياد تي اجازت ڏئي ٿو. غلطي جي سنڀال: جانچيو ته ڇا API غلطي جي صورت ۾ مناسب غلطي جا پيغام ۽ ڪوڊ موٽائي ٿو. ڪارڪردگي: API جي جواب جو وقت، throughput، ۽ لوڊ هيٺ اسڪيلبلٽي کي جانچيو. سيڪيورٽي: API کي SQL injection، cross-site scripting (XSS)، ۽ cross-site request forgery (CSRF) جهڙين خطرن لاءِ جانچيو.
3
0
Softwaretester Community
The softwaretester community, chat, and discussion.
29 جانون
ابھي تائين ڪو تبصرو ناهي!
نئين ماڻهن سان ملو
50,000,000+ DOWNLOADS